施肥对典型红壤区桉树人工林土壤理化性质的影响 被引量:5

Effects of Fertilization on Soil Physical and Chemical Characteristics of Eucalyptus robusta Plantations in Typical Red Soil Area

摘要 桉树人工林短轮伐期经营对地力消耗严重,特别是在亚热带的红壤区极易造成水土流失。科学施肥能较好地改善桉树林的土壤养分状况,有利于土壤中养分的释放。通过不同的施肥试验,结果表明,各施肥处理土壤养分含量均高于对照组(CK),表明施肥能有效提高土壤肥力,其中以A2B1处理为最优。各样地土壤有机质、氨态氮、速效磷、速效钾含量总体上均随土层深度的增加而下降,且不同土层间均存在显著差异。相关性分析表明,各土壤理化指标间存在复杂的耦合关系。 Short rotation of Eucalyptus robusta plantations causes serious soil nutrient consumption,especially in subtropical red soil area,which is easy to cause water loss and soil erosion.Scientific fertilization can improve the soil nutrient status of Eucalyptus robusta plantations,and is beneficial to soil nutrients release.Through different fertilization experiments,the results showed that the nutrient content of each fertilization treatment group was higher than that of the control group,which indicated that fertilization could effectively improve soil fertility,of which A2B1 treatment was the best.The contents of soil organic matter,ammonia nitrogen,available phosphorus and available potassium decreased with the increase of soil layer depth,and there were significant differences among different soil layers.The correlation analysis showed that there were complex coupling relationships among the soil physical and chemical indexes.
